Sr. Oracle Database Administrator Resume
Eagan, MN
SUMMARY
- Diligent Oracle DBA with 8+ years of proven experience in maintaining databases running on various platforms with providing high availability of data to the end users.
- Comprehensive experience as Oracle DBA, especially in Exadata, Oracle Golden Gate, Data Guard, Oracle RAC, proficient in Oracle 10g/11g/12c/18c/19c software installations, migrations, database capacity planning, automated backup implementation, performance tuning on Linux/Unix, Windows and Exadata platform.
- Extensive knowledge on database administration for Oracle 10g, 11g, 12c, 18c, 19c with experience in very large scale database environments and mission critical large OLTP and OLAP systems.
- Provided architecture design and implemented all production database replication, backup and contingency recovery strategies for all OLTP and OLAP Data Warehouse databases.
- Administrated and supported 200+ global development and production Oracle 11g, 12c and MS SQL server databases including Oracle ERP systems.
- Experienced with installation and maintenance of ORACLE 10g RAC/11gRAC/12c RAC and standby database for High Availability and Disaster Recovery purpose.
- Administered Oracle Clusterware and resources on 11g and 12c using CRSCTL/SRVCTL.
- Migrated OS file system storage to ASM with minimal downtime and administered ASM disks.
- Expertise in configuring Active Dataguard, Snapshot standby and troubleshooting issues and configuring Service Level Agreements for query’s accessing standby databases.
- Migrated databases into Exadata Machine with minimal downtime using Data guard.
- Proven experience in RAC Clusterware administration, Configuration and Patching.
- Expertise in configuring and implementing ASM and proficient in using ASMCMD and ASMLIB and configuring ASM disk groups using ASMCA and SYSASM.
- Migrated and upgraded Oracle Database from 11.2.0.4 on Solaris/Windows to 12.2.0.2 on Linux environment using Datapump and Bi - Directional Golden Gate replication.
- Setup Oracle Enterprise Manager (OEM) 11g & Grid Control (12c) for database monitoring/performance/diagnostics.
- Good knowledge on logical and physical Data Modeling using normalizing Techniques.
- Proven Experience in installing and administrating RAC environments on Oracle Exadata .
- Deep understanding about Exadata specified features such as Smart Scan, HCC Hybrid Columnar Compression, Flash Cache, etc .
- Implemented new Exadata Machine features like smart scan, Flash Logging, Storage Index, HCC and enabling Smart Scan on Exadata Databases.
- Worked on Exadata Database Machine X3-2, X4-2, X6-2, X6-4, X7-2
- Experienced in Patching and Upgradation from 9i, 10g, 11g, 12c, 18c .
- Good experience in Patching PSU and CPU Patches Quarterly and Upgradation of databases from versions from 10g, 11g to 12c and to 18c.
- Experienced in Performance Tuning using EXPLAIN PLAN, SQLTRACE, TKPROF, STATSPACK, AWR and ADDM.
- Extensive experience in Database Backups RMAN (F ull/Incremental backups) and in traditional hot/cold backups.
- Experience in LOGICAL BACKUPS and Database migration tools with DATA PUMP, Export/Import and Transportable Tablespaces .
- Involved in Building Oracle Global Data Services (GDS).
- Provided On-Call 24x7 production DBA support, application/development DBA.
- Proficient in SQL, PL/SQL, Stored Procedures, Functions, Cursors and Triggers .
- Experienced in Database Refresh and patch management and in Database cloning with RMAN.
- Excellent Communication skills, co-ordination and communication with system administrators, business data analysts and development teams and providing technical directions to teams.
- Experienced and Strong knowledge in UNIX Shell scripting, and extensively used to automate jobs (Batch, Backups, Refresh etc.)
TECHNICAL SKILLS
RDBMS: Oracle 19c, 18c, 12c, 11g, 10g, 12cRAC, 11gRAC, SQL Server
Operating Systems: Linux (OEL), Redhat, Solaris, Windows, AIX
Hardware: Oracle Exadata X2/X3/X4/X6 Full rack and Half Rack machines.
Data Replication: Golden Gate (Uni-Directional & Bi-Directional)
High Availability: RAC, Data Guard, Golden Gate
Tools: & Utilities: OEM 13c, TOAD, SQL Developer, SQL* Loader, Data Pump, RMAN, TKPROF, Explain Plan, Statspack, ADDM, AWR, ASH, SQL Tuning Advisor, EXP/IMP, ORACHECK, ORATOP
Web Technology/ Fusion Middleware: Oracle WebLogic, OBIEE
Languages: C, Java, PL/SQL, UNIX Shell Script, SQL
PROFESSIONAL EXPERIENCE
Confidential, Eagan, MN
Sr. Oracle Database Administrator
Responsibilities:
- As a Senior Oracle DBA provided advanced technical support to enterprise DBA team on Oracle database related technologies such as Exadata, Golden Gate, Streams, RAC, upgrades, migration, Performance Tuning, Backup and Recovery, RMAN, Partitioning, Oracle Enterprise Manager, SQL, PL/SQL, Code review and optimization, Materialized views, Flashback, troubleshooting, Data pump, RDBMS security, VLDB, optimize server resource utilization etc.
- Working with primary DBAs in the DB support team, support the mission critical OLTP and Data Warehouse production databases.
- Migrated Number of critical Oracle Databases from 11.2.0.4 running on sun Solaris server to 12.2.0.2 running on OEL.
- Installed 4 node RAC cluster on 12.2.0.2 and migrated the database from 11g to 12c using Golden Gate, RMAN and DATA Pump.
- Installed and configured High Availability Oracle Golden Gate (OGG) systems on Oracle 11gR2 and 12c RAC environments (Front-end Sun SPARC Server, Back-end Oracle Exadata Full Rack).
- Upgrade Oracle Golden Gate from 11gR2 to 12c. Implement OGG 12c new features in mission-critical production environments.
- Involved in database troubleshooting and maintenance activities and resolved Golden Gate issues such like abended, lagging, long transaction issues.
- Installed ASM environment and migrated database from Non-ASM to ASM.
- Administered Oracle ASM disk groups (mirroring, compatibility) with Oracle ASM Configuration Assistant (ASMCA).
- Expert in SRVCTL and CRSCTL to manager RAC environment activities.
- Installed and configured 12c & 13c Oracle Enterprise Manager (OEM) and monitored top SQLs.
- Migrated Oracle database 12c to 18c from Linux Boxes to EXADATA 6-2 machine using Golden Gate and Export &Import.
- Installed OJVM patch on 12.2.0.2 databases on Exadata X3 environments before migrating it to Exadata X6 machines to match with Bundle patch version.
- Worked with Storage team in configuring NetBackup and Data domain on Exadata X6.
- Software and firmware maintenance of the Exadata storage servers in the Database machine including routine health check, patching and upgrades according to the suggestions from Oracle support department.
- Installed and configured oracle 18c database and migrated the data from 12c to 18c using Oracle Golden Gate Bi-Directional Replication.
- Configured GoldenGate downstream mining and integrated components for Active-Passive and Active-Active replication.
- Configured GoldenGate High availability using Oracle DBFS and Active Dataguard.
- Experienced in performing Point-in-Time Recovery .
- Installed and Configured GoldenGate JAgent to work with OEM GoldenGate plugin.
- Configured Dataguard for high availability/disaster recovery purpose and configured to switchover and failover.
- Configured Physical Standby databases using data guard in maximum performance & availability and Converted Physical standby to Snapshot Standby 11g, 12c, 18c accordingly.
- Installed Oracle Global Data Services (GDS) for managing workloads.
- Involved in Global Service Manger (GMS) Listener setup to incoming database connections.
- Created GDS catalog database on GSM server and setup Administrative accounts & granted privileges and Configured GDS pools accordingly and configured client Connectivity.
- Deployed GDS Services and created GDS admin user and catalog user and granted roles and privileges accordingly and used GDSCTL to configure and added listener services of catalog database and added the services and made sure that GDS connectivity is in TNS entry.
- Installed Oracle 19c in Test Environments and configured fully functional 19c database.
- Exposed Oracle 19c new features and documented all the related functionalities for other DBA’s.
- Developed RMAN scripts for database backup and recovery including hot and cold backup options for both RAC and stand-alone instances.
- Developed UNIX shell scripts and setting up cronjobs that automate database monitoring.
- Executed and provided ADDM, AWR and database health check reports to information owners and recommended solutions for improved performance.
- Optimization and tuning SQL queries using TRACE FILE, TKPROF, EXPLAIN PLAN.
- Partitioned large tables for better performance and manageability.
- Applied CPU Patches and PSU Patches.
- Created User accounts, Roles and granting required access permissions and privileges to users.
- Cloned/Refreshed Oracle Databases and Oracle Applications when needed.
- Provided 24X7 support for all the production and development databases.
Environment: Oracle 19c/18c/12c/11g, SQL Developer, Toad, Mobaxterm, GoldenGate, DataGuard, RAC, RMAN, DataPump, Exadata, AWR, ASH, ADDM, Putty, Servicenow
Confidential, Minneapolis, MN
Sr. Oracle Database Administrator
Responsibilities:
- Provided architecture design and implemented all production database replication, backup and contingency recovery strategies for all OLTP and OLAP Data Warehouse databases.
- Installed and Configured 4 Node RAC on 12.2.0.2 and administrated databases and maintained high availability of data with minimal downtime.
- Adding a New Node to RAC cluster and Installed Oracle RDBMS software on new node of cluster and Created ASM Volume using ASMCA.
- Installed and configured transactional level DDL, DML, BI-DIRECTIONAL replication using GoldenGate.
- Performance tuning, GoldenGate replication and used Log dump and report files for troubleshooting.
- Implemented GoldenGate Replication 11g/12c on ACFS and configured for Automatic failover of GoldenGate process and Handy in upgrading GoldenGate from v11 to 12c.
- Deep understanding about Exadata specified features such as Smart Scan, HCC Hybrid Columnar Compression, Flash Cache, etc.
- Provide and implement performance tuning recommendations of all components in Exadata.
- Advice, provide guidance and develop Disaster Recovery strategies for the Exadata Database machine.
- Working on Exadata X6 and X4 machines which included Half Rack and Full Rack
- Configured and modified Exadata x6.2 machines as per confidential requirement and specifications after Oracle handed over the standard Exadata machines.
- Involved in Upgrading and Migrating 15TB of Oracle databases on Oracle 11g, 12c.
- Analyzed the user requirements and designed partitioned tables for improving performance of Data Marts.
- Performed Partition Maintenance and automated the process of creating new Partitions as and when required.
- Used OEM 11g and 12c grid control for monitoring multiple databases and notification of database alerts and configured EM agents on multiple database servers.
- In-depth understanding Oracle Goldengate internal mechanism, OGG new features such as integrated capture, coordinate apply mode, multi-threaded replication. Developed home cooked OGG lag monitoring scripts and configure OGG monitoring plug-in in OEM
- Performed Daily Monitoring of Oracle Instances, monitor users, and Table spaces, Memory Structures, Rollback Segments, Logs and Alerts
- Creation of database objects like Tables, Indexes, Views, Users, and DB Links etc.
- Configured backup & recovery solutions using RMAN and NetBackup, Troubleshooting RMAN and resolved issues, performed Block Recovery, Data file Recovery.
- Trouble shooting various database performances by proper diagnosis at all levels like SQL, PL/SQL, database design, database tables, indexes, instance, memory.
- Performed health checks and monitored logs and CPU, memory, I/O and disk usage on production and application servers.
- Performance tuning of databases using AWR, ASH reports, ADDM reports, provided instance level performance monitoring and tuning for Event Waits, Sessions.
Environment: Oracle 12c/11g, RAC, Exadata, OEM, RMAN, DataPump, GoldenGate, ASM
Confidential
Oracle Database Administrator
Responsibilities:
- Administrative maintenance, monitoring on Oracle database systems in a global 24x7 environment. Worked in Real Application Clusters (RAC), ASM, RMAN, and Data Guard and maintain Standby database.
- Performed health checks of RAC Clusterware components OCR, voting files and backups using ocrconfig.
- Installed, configured and maintained Oracle 12cR2 Real Application Cluster (RAC) 3 node RAC, migrating single Instance Databases to 3 Node RAC environments.
- Installed the 3 node RAC for the 12c database and administered the 12c databases on these RAC servers.
- Administration and troubleshooting 11g and 12c RAC Clusterware using Clusterware logs. Worked with VMware team in building new servers, performing Clusterware installation, and RAC RDBMS installation.
- Experience in logical backups and database migration tools with Data Pump, Export/Import and Transportable Tablespaces.
- Configured Physical Standby databases using Data Guard in maximum performance & max availability and Converted Physical standby to Snapshot Standby in 11g, 12c.
- Performance Tuning: Tuned various large critical OLAP and OLTP databases of Terabytes size using various tools such as AWR, ASH, SQL-Trace, Tkprof, ADDM, SQL tuning using Explain Plans and Hints.
- Performed Zero-Down Time migration from AIX to RHEL using Expdp and GoldenGate and process improvement for GoldenGate by proactive monitoring using Shell scripts.
- Used GoldenGate 12c new features: Configured Integrated Extract, Integrated Replication coordinated replication Oracle multitenant database 12.1.0.2.
- Implemented GoldenGate Replication 11g/12c on ACFS and configured for Automatic failover of GoldenGate process and handy in upgrading GoldenGate
Environment: Oracle 12c/11g, RAC, DataGuard, GoldenGate, DataPump, ASM, AWR, ASH, RMAN.
Confidential
Oracle Database Administrator
Responsibilities:
- Installed and configured oracle 11.2.0.4 database and upgraded the database from 11.2.0.2 to 11.2.0.4.
- Configured Active DataGuard and maintained physical standby databases.
- Troubleshooting Dataguard using Views, troubleshooting missing archive log scenario, patching Dataguard environment, applied logs with delay Configured Dataguard Broker and managed standby databases using DG broker.
- Worked on Exadata X2-2 and x3-2 machines and migrated databases using Expdp, GoldenGate and Dataguard.
- Worked on different Features of Exadata x3-2: Hybrid column compression, Smart scan, Flash Logging, DCLI, create and drop Flash disks, Flash Logging, Enabling Flash Cache Compression, Cell monitoring and Alerts, Cell Offload Efficiency, Hybrid columnar compression.
- Applied PSU and CPU Patches as per the requirements and when needed.
- Configured Data guard broker between the primary and standby databases, perform Switchover/Failover and monitor the data guard status via command line and GUI.
- Converted physical standby to Snapshot standby and back to physical standby.
- Configure and build Golden Gate Extracts/replicate for multiple databases, Configure and build heartbeat monitoring in Golden Gate.
- Experience in logical backups and Database migration tools with Data Pump, Export/Import and Transportable Table-spaces.
- Making sure that proper RMAN backups are in place as part of a daily job
Environment: DataGuard, GoldenGate, RMAN, DataPump, Exadata.
Confidential
Oracle DBA
Responsibilities:
- Installation, setup & configuration of Oracle 10gR2 RAC & single instance databases.
- Perform monitoring, administration & troubleshooting of Oracle databases.
- Monitor and troubleshoot database backups, disk space, and server availability.
- Setup, configuration and management of Oracle Enterprise Manager.
- Managed the databases using OEM.
- Monitoring the table space growth and resizing the table space
- Experience in moving the data from one server to another server using SFTP, FTP and SCP.
- Involved in construction of Disaster Recovery (DR) for all the production databases.
- Grant and Revoked user privileges and roles as per requirement and killed blocking session.
- Installed Standalone servers on ASM and migrated databases to ASM.
- Provided instance level performance monitoring and tuning for Event Waits, Sessions, Physical and Logical I/O and Memory Usage.
- Contact to the development team to solve the issues with the new enhancement releases.
- Installation, configuration, upgrade and performance tuning of Oracle RAC.
- Managing Schema Objects like Tables, Views and Indexes.
- Making database backups and performing recovery when necessary.
- Managing the database storage structures.
Environment: Oracle 10g, RAC, DataGuard, ASM, DataPump, RMAN, OEM